After having lost a blowout in their previous game against Liberty Union, Amanda-Clearcreek was happy to have turned things around on Saturday. They walked away with a 12-9 victory over the Athens Bulldogs. That's more bragging rights for the Aces,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.

The win got Amanda-Clearcreek back to even at 2-2. As for Athens, they now have a losing record of 2-3.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ming contests. Amanda-Clearcreek will square off against Fairfield Union at 5:15 p.m. on Monday. The Falcons' pitching crew has only allowed 2.2 runs per game this season, so the Aces' hitters will have their work cut out for them. As for Athens, they will head out on the road to square off against Alexander at 5:00 p.m. on Monday.
